Role of Biodiesel in India's Energy Mix

Biodiesel plays a crucial role in India's energy supply, offering a sustainable and renewable alternative to traditional fossil fuels. Currently, biodiesel accounts for a small but growing portion of India's energy mix. However, with the completion of Aemetis, Inc.'s expansion project, the increased production capacity of 60 million gallons per year is expected to contribute significantly to the country's energy diversification efforts.

India's energy mix primarily consists of fossil fuels such as coal, petroleum, and natural gas. While these sources have served as the backbone of the country's energy supply, they come with significant environmental challenges, including air pollution and greenhouse gas emissions. Biodiesel, on the other hand, is derived from renewable sources such as vegetable oils and animal fats, making it a cleaner and more sustainable option.

Compared to other renewable energy sources in India, such as solar and wind power, biodiesel offers certain advantages. It is highly compatible with existing diesel engines and infrastructure, requiring minimal modifications. This makes it a feasible option for addressing the energy needs of sectors heavily reliant on diesel, such as transportation and agriculture.

Furthermore, biodiesel production has the potential to create new job opportunities and boost rural economies by supporting agricultural activities and local industries. It promotes sustainable farming practices and provides an additional source of income for farmers through the cultivation of oilseed crops.

While biodiesel is currently a small player in India's energy mix, the increased production capacity resulting from Aemetis, Inc.'s expansion will likely lead to a more prominent role. As India continues to prioritize clean energy and sustainable development, biodiesel can contribute significantly to reducing carbon emissions, improving air quality, and achieving the country's energy goals.
